## Runbook: Gaugepile Sidecar — Release Checklist

Heads up: the sidecar ships with every app pod, so a bad config fans out fast. Before cutting a release, confirm the flush interval hasn't drifted from what the Tallyhouse aggregator expects, or you'll see sawtooth gaps in dashboards. Rollbacks are cheap — just repin the image tag. Canary one node pool first, watch for ten minutes, then proceed. The values to verify against are these.

config for bagep-yafof:
quenath:
  pin: 8584
  metrics_host: metrics.quenath.tolvaqsys.internal
  tenant: pelath
  seal: seal_ed102645

**Vendor note: Inkmill markdown pipeline**

Rendering for Parchway docs is outsourced to Inkmill under an annual contract, renewing each March. They handle sanitization and PDF export; we own the upload queue. SLA: 4-hour response on rendering failures. Escalate only after two failed retries. Their support desk is reachable at the address below.

billing contact of hahaf-baguf = zorael.tammir.jorius@sivrelhq.internal

## LagSentinel 2.4 — default changes for plugin authors

We have revised the read-replica lag alarm defaults to reduce noisy pages. The warning threshold rises from 5 to 15 seconds, and the critical threshold from 30 to 60 seconds. Evaluation now uses a three-sample rolling median rather than a single reading, so plugins reacting to raw samples should adapt. Hooks fire after debouncing, not before. The new default configuration block is reproduced here.

config for kajog-tadug:
[casax]
port = 11211
region = west-3
host = casax.nelvroworks.internal
timeout_ms = 5000
retries = 7

Impact: quotes may apply outdated rates; invoices are unaffected because they revalidate at posting. Auto-refresh retries every ten minutes; the alert clears on the next successful sync. Review recent changes to the cache warmer before approving any merge that touches the refresh scheduler. Known noisy window: upstream publishes nightly around 02:00. For refresh override approval, write to the owners here.

escalation mailbox, bafog-fafog: ulador@paliqlabs.internal